
In this study, TEGDMA-DHEPT microcapsules were synthesized and characterized for quality in a laboratory setting. The process involved in situ polymerization of PUF shells and subsequent characterization included size analysis, optical and SEM microscopy, and FT-IR spectrometry. Results indicated an average diameter of 120 ± 45 μm for the microcapsules, with SEM imaging revealing a smooth outer surface and PUF nanoparticle deposits. FT-IR spectra demonstrated a 60.3% degree of conversion when microcapsules were crushed with a BPO catalyst. The findings suggest potential applications in dental resin composites with self-healing properties to be explored in future research.
